DGFT mandates electronic filing of India-Oman CEPA preferential CoO on Trade Connect from June 1
Exporters to Oman under CEPA must apply for the preferential CoO electronically on Trade Connect from June 1, 2026
- — Export documentation teams shipping to Oman under CEPA preference from 1 June 2026 must file each Certificate of Origin through the Trade Connect ePlatform under the "India Oman CEPA (Agency Issued)" agreement — no preferential CoO issues outside the platform from that date, so an off-platform request cannot support the tariff claim.
- — Exporters' IEC and DSC administrators must reconcile the Trade Connect user-profile name against the Digital Signature Certificate name and refresh IEC details before filing, because a name mismatch or stale IEC blocks agency and applicant selection during the eCOO application.

- — 1 June 2026: India-Oman CEPA enters into force and preferential eCOO issuance opens on Trade Connect — preferential CoO must be filed through the platform from this date.
